| Name | 5-iodouracil |
|---|---|
| Synonym | More Synonyms |
| Density | 2.4±0.1 g/cm3 |
|---|---|
| Boiling Point | 401ºC |
| Melting Point | 274-276 °C (dec.)(lit.) |
| Molecular Formula | C4H3IN2O2 |
| Molecular Weight | 237.983 |
| Exact Mass | 237.923904 |
| PSA | 66.24000 |
| LogP | 0.14 |
| Index of Refraction | 1.706 |
| Storage condition | 0-6°C |
| Water Solubility | SOLUBLE IN COLD WATER |
